dotsFilter

rdts.filters.Filter.dotsFilter
object dotsFilter extends Filter[Dots]

Attributes

Graph
Supertypes
trait Filter[Dots]
class Object
trait Matchable
class Any
Self type
dotsFilter.type

Members list

Value members

Concrete methods

override def filter(delta: Dots, permission: PermissionTree): Dots

Attributes

Definition Classes
override def minimizePermissionTree(permissionTree: PermissionTree): PermissionTree

Attributes

Definition Classes
override def validatePermissionTree(permissionTree: PermissionTree): Unit

Checks whether the permission tree is valid.

Checks whether the permission tree is valid.

  • Not DENY & ALLOW on the same level

  • All fields exist

Value parameters

permissionTree

The tree to check

Attributes

Returns

Success(the validated permission tree) or a Failure(with the cause).

Definition Classes